Output dd30621ff6437a98fc5403e895bcd2feff02d0792e7e51288a36ace32d7c07ed:0

value
6962204480421
script pubkey
OP_0 OP_PUSHBYTES_20 80c83fd0f29277e95e85e53e09dd66c146f14d66
address
tb1qsryrl58jjfm7jh59u5lqnhtxc9r0zntxdrsq8a
transaction
dd30621ff6437a98fc5403e895bcd2feff02d0792e7e51288a36ace32d7c07ed
confirmations
152614
spent
true